(modifié le 6 octobre 2017 à 3:59)

Il existe de nombreuses applications pour recevoir des notifications par push comme pushbullet ou pushingbox. Mais vous pouvez avoir envie de recevoir un bon vieux SMS.

Et il existe aujourd'hui tellement d'opérateurs qu'il est difficile de s'y retrouver.

Pourquoi du SMS  ?

Le SMS fonctionne partout, tout le temps. Pas besoin d'avoir une liaison internet, une API avec un service tiers et j'en passe. Le nombre d'intérmédiaire étant limité il y a peu de chance qu'un SMS n'arrive pas (sauf au réveillon...).

De plus il est très facile avec un SMS de notifier plusieurs personnes, alors qu'avec le push il faut déjà installer l'application partout, être en mesure de recevoir de la data... quand tu es en itinérance orange avec free mobile tu peux attendre longtemps. De plus si vous êtes à l'étranger recevoir un SMS n'est généralement pas facturé, alors que le roaming coûte très cher.

Enfin il y a un avantage indéniable : pouvoir envoyer des SMS à votre centrale domotique pour déclencher des actions (trigger). Bien sûr il faudra filtrer le numéro source pouvant effectuer des actions pour plus de sécurité. Je ne me suis pas encore penché dessus mais cela fait partie des motivations pour le choix du SMS.

J'ai donc acheté un dongle 3G Huawei pour 5€ port inclus sur leboncoin et je vous ferai un billet dédié sur cette partie en incluant tous les scripts bash qui vont avec.

Quel opérateur

Maintenant que vous êtes convaincu par le SMS il est temps de choisir un opérateur téléphonique mobile.

De nombreux forfaits à 2€ permettent une utilisation de SMS illimités, voir de MMS, incluant aussi quelques mo de data que je n'utiliserai pas. Mais il y a quelque chose à prendre en compte : le prix de la SIM ainsi que le coût l'expédition.

Certains opérateurs comme Free facturent 10€ à l'inscription pour le forfait 2€. Et ça représente tout de même 5 mois de forfait, loin d'être négligeable ! C'est comme si l'on payait 100€ d'expédition sur le forfait à 20€. Bref c'est déconnant et c'est pourquoi il faut voir ailleurs.

En gardant un numéro existant

Si vous avez une carte SIM active à reconvertir alors c'est parfait. Dans ce cas vous pouvez foncer chez Free et prendre un forfait à 2€. En optant pour la portabilité la SIM et l'expédition sont gratuites.

Attetion à ne pas acheter la SIM dans une borne de distribution automatique (Free Center, bureaux de tabacs...) car vous serez aussi facturé de 10€ !

Si vous êtes client Freebox alors l'abonnement passe de 2€ à 0€. Dans ce cas c'est plus qu'une bonne affaire 🙂

Création d'un nouveau numéro

C'est là où c'est un peu plus la jungle. L'idée c'est de souscrire chez un opérateur qui ne facture pas la SIM pour ensuite passer chez un opérateur proposant un forfait à 2€.

On trouve de nombreux opérateurs qui offrent la SIM et l'expédition mais imposent un rechargement d'un montant minimum pour l'activation de la carte ou pour obtenir le numéro RIO. Autrement dit ce n'est plus une bonne affaire.

Oubliez donc les opérateurs suivants : lebara mobile, lycamobile, vectone mobile.

Je peux vous conseiller 2 opérateurs :

  • Coriolis : SIM à 1€
  • Syma mobile : SIM gratuite

J'ai déjà testé Coriolis chez qui j'avais souscrit un forfait à 2€ pendant 6 mois incluant SMS/MMS illimités et 2H d'appel. J'ai donc payé la SIM 1€ et après 2 mois d'utilisation je suis passé chez Free Mobile en portant le numéro. Contrairement à Free Coriolis propose une SIM triple découpe, pratique. J'ai rencontré quelques soucis à l'inscription mais le support a été très réactif. Coriolis est un MVNO basé sur SFR.

Mais c'est sans compter l'opérateur Syma vient de sortir une nouvelle offre très attractive. Un forfait à 1,90€/mois incluant SMS/MMS illimités, 3h d'appels, 500 mo de data (10x plus que free) avec une SIM gratuite. Difficile de faire mieux. Syma est un MVNO basé sur le réseau Orange.

Je n'ai pas pu tester Syma comme opérateur donc si vous êtes client n'hésitez pas à me donner votre avis.

Pour savoir à tout moment quel est le meilleur rapport qualité prix / coût expédition SIM rendez-vous sur l'excellent site lebonforfait.

Restrictions sur les SMS Flash

J'utilise mon Raspberry Pi pour envoyer des SMS Flash. Il s'agit de SMS de classe 0 qui s'affiche sous forme de popup. Vous savez ce sont ces messages qui s'affichent alors même qu'on n'a pas encore ouvert l'application SMS.

Sur certains appareils comme iPhone il est strictement impossible de voir le numéro expéditeur, et je trouve ça complètement abérrant d'un point de vue sécurité. Vous pouvez très bien marquer "Orange info : votre compte est désactivé cliquez ici http://...." avec une URL malveillante.

Sur Android c'est très variable, certains l'affichent comme un SMS normal, d'autres en popup avec la possibilité de l'enregistrer, et donc de voir l'expéditeur.

Ce mode popup est idéal pour recevoir des notifications qui sont inutiles à mémoriser. Le matin mon Raspberry Pi m'envoie la température extérieure, l'humidité et la qualité de l'air. Des informations bonnes à savoir puisque je circule en vélo : s'il fait très humide attention à la pluie, et pour l'air pollué alors je ralentis la cadence pour ne pas trop absorber de polluants.

Voici un petit résumé suivant la possibilité d'envoi de SMS flash chez les opérateurs :

  • Coriolis, Orange, Sosh, Bouygues : flash autorisé
  • Free Mobile : flash non autorisé, reçu comme un sms normal
  • SFR : pas testé

Pour tester l'envoie d'un SMS Flash sous Gammu :

gammu -c /home/pi/.gammurc sendsms TEXT 0612345678 -validity 6HOURS -flash

Je vous invite à me remonter vos tests afin que je mette à jour le billet 🙂

Auteur : Mr Xhark

Fondateur du blog et passionné par les nouvelles techno, suivez-moi sur twitter